The Cover
A South American newcomer to
Texas, that has quickly made itself
at home, the nutria prefers a semiaquatic
life in swamps, marshes,
rivers and lakes. These docile creatures,
nocturnal and almost entirely
vegetarian, are now in growing
demand for their fur.
Painting by Joseph Maniscalco.
